Activities

What Participants Can Expect Within Each Programme

Activities are chosen for accessibility, repetition, and therapeutic usefulness rather than performance or intensity.

Breathwork and Down-Regulation

Sessions include guided breathing and settling practices to support nervous system regulation and a calmer baseline.

Supported Movement

Movement options are practical and modifiable, helping participants build confidence without unnecessary strain.

Home Practice Guidance

Participants leave with realistic exercises and rest practices that can be sustained between sessions.
